From aa08c8037de146a8b5adce34a08757ebb61f9cbb Mon Sep 17 00:00:00 2001 From: Brian Shaughnessy Date: Wed, 10 Mar 2021 10:47:58 -0500 Subject: [PATCH] dev/core#2453 cast balance due to float --- CRM/Contribute/Form/Contribution/Main.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/CRM/Contribute/Form/Contribution/Main.php b/CRM/Contribute/Form/Contribution/Main.php index d6df12bd1f..b6c29b41fc 100644 --- a/CRM/Contribute/Form/Contribution/Main.php +++ b/CRM/Contribute/Form/Contribution/Main.php @@ -1472,7 +1472,7 @@ class CRM_Contribute_Form_Contribution_Main extends CRM_Contribute_Form_Contribu $paymentBalance = CRM_Contribute_BAO_Contribution::getContributionBalance($this->_ccid); //bounce if the contribution is not pending. - if ((int) $paymentBalance <= 0) { + if ((float) $paymentBalance <= 0) { CRM_Core_Error::statusBounce(ts("Returning since contribution has already been handled.")); } if (!empty($paymentBalance)) { -- 2.25.1